Democratie sanitaire, democratie en sante, empowerment des malades : quels que soient les vocables utilises, la participation des patients semble admise. D'objets de soins, ils seraient enfin reconnus par les institutions comme citoyens a part entiere, sujets conscients, responsables et capables. Un tel consensus est a interroger. L'histoire tumultueuse de la democratie sanitaire est faite de conflits, de compromis, de victoires et d'echecs. Contrairement aux idees recues, elle ne commence pas aux annees sida. Des le XIXe siecle les malades ont combattu pour etre entendus. Ils se sont organises et ont ete actifs. Comment ont-ils contribue a impulser une dynamique democratique ? Sous quelles formes se developpe-t-elle actuellement ? Quelles sont les ambiguites des dispositifs institutionnels contemporains ?Alors que nous avons celebre les 20 ans de la loi sur les droits des malades, les difficultes du passe aident a comprendre les tensions persistantes du present. Par cette mise en perspective completee par une enquete de terrain en milieu hospitalier, Lucile Sergent pose un regard neuf sur le rapport des citoyens au systeme de sante. Elle propose de nouvelles ressources et un outillage pour penser la participation des malades et les politiques mises en ¿uvre.

This volume delves into the potential that design thinking can have when applied to organizational systems and structures in health care environments to mitigate risks, reduce medical errors and ultimately improve patient safety, the quality of care, provider well-being, and the overall patient experience.

"A Psychiatrist's Guide to Advocacy explores the diverse conditions that may demand an in-tervention or affirmative response from mental health practitioners charged with advocating for patients and the profession. The editors and authors argue for a greater culture of advo-cacy among psychiatrists to effect broad and lasting changes, emphasizing that advocacy takes many forms (e.g., organizational, patient-level, legislative, media, education). The au-thors identify systemic problems in mental health care, describe the essential factors needed for effective advocacy, and delineate the advocacy needs of diverse patient populations (e.g., children and families, older adults, LGBTQ patients, veterans)"--
